About St Martin's Academy Chester
St Martin's Academy Chester was judged Outstanding in every category during its most recent Ofsted inspection in December 2024, a rating it has now held across two consecutive inspections. The school's academic performance is particularly striking: 84% of its Year 6 pupils met the expected standard in reading, writing and maths combined in the 2023/24 academic year, well above the local authority average of 61%. This places St Martin's 9th out of 110 primary schools in Cheshire West and Chester, comfortably inside the top 10% of schools in the area. In the North West region, it ranks 106th out of 2,065 primary schools, and nationally it sits in the top 6% of all schools. The school's reading and maths average scores both sit at 108, while 100% of pupils reached the expected standard in writing and 92% did so in maths.
